The Pan-Mass Challenge’s (PMC) annual bike ride fundraiser broke records with this year’s $63 million donation to the Dana-Farber Cancer Institute in Boston. The PMC has exclusively raised $717 million for Dana-Farber over its 40-year history. We chatted with PMC Founder and Executive Director Billy Starr and PMC Director of Stewardship Meredith Beaton-Starr to learn more about the organization’s history and commitment to Dana-Farber. Dana-Farber president and chief executive Dr. Laurie Glimcher explains how the funds impact patient care and research. Over 150 Dana-Farber employees participated in the last ride, including Dr. Katherine Janeway, who was a cancer patient at the hospital herself.

Laurie Glimcher: That’s actually incorrect. There are four immunotherapy drugs that are currently being marketed. Two of them are so called checkpoint blockers. And those are drugs that activate the key immune cell, it’s called the T-cell, to come in and kill the tumor. They activate your own endogenous immune system to kill the tumor. There are about 10 or maybe even 11 types of cancer that have been shown to be responsive to immunotherapy, and that includes cancers like melanoma, lung cancer, liver cancer, kidney and bladder cancers, head and neck cancer, Merkel cell cancer, and a few others that actually can be responsive to immunotherapy, but not every patient with those 10 or 11 cancers responds. And then there are tumors that have been intransigent and nonresponsive, so-called cold tumors that don’t respond to immunotherapy. So two of the immunotherapeutics out there are directed against inhibitory receptors on T-cells, and those drugs are the PD1, PDL1 blockers and the blockers of CTLA4 which is another inhibitory receptor. The other two immunotherapy drugs are Car T cells and those are effective in some liquid malignancies, lymphoma and leukemia in particular. So taken altogether, I would say the numbers around 20% of all cancer patients would respond to immunotherapy. So clearly we’re at the tip of the iceberg here.

Laurie Glimcher: I would say there was very little progress until about 15 to 20 years ago. You know, it was pretty much flat. You treated patients with cancer, with chemotherapy and radiation therapy and surgery, and if you had stage one cancer, you could be cured because it could be surgically removed if you had metastatic cancer, you know, your future wasn’t bright. But two amazing revolutions occurred in the last 15 years. One of them was the discovery that tumor cells arise from normal cells because they sustain genetic mutations and that launched the field of precision medicine or targeted genomics. So we offer every patient that’s seen at Dana Farber the opportunity to have their tumor sequenced. No other cancer center does that. And we can only do that because it’s not reimbursable by health care insurance companies because we’ve raised philanthropic funds and some of the funds that we raised through the PMC for example, go to supporting that: to allowing us to sequence the tumors of every patient who wants to have their tumor sequenced
Emily Kumler: And why would somebody want to do that, is probably an important thing to ask?
Laurie Glimcher: Why? Because we have some drugs that target those genetic mutations and I think we’ve identified now, we and other cancer centers, almost every genetic mutation that a patient tumor has and have developed a number of drugs that target that mutation. At Dana Farber, we were instrumental, for example, in developing drugs that target the mutation in the EGF receptor, which is common in about 20 to 30% of lung cancer patients and if you treat those patients with the drugs that target that receptor, they can experience amazing remissions that can last for years sometimes.

The same thing for kidney cancer with immunotherapy and many other cancers. So I actually don’t agree with your assessment. The last 15 years have been remarkable. They have been an enormous inflection point for the treatment of cancer. The amount of knowledge we have now about the genetic mutations that drive cancer and the success of immunotherapy. I mean, immunotherapy has been around, we’ve tried to activate our own immune systems for over a century, starting with, with a surgeon in New York City, Dr. William Coley, who made the prescient observation that some of the, I think it was young men with sarcoma. He had several patients. He noticed that when he removed the tumor and the wound got infected, sometimes those tumors didn’t recur when they ordinarily would have. And so he said there must be some system in the body that when it’s responding to bacteria, also kills the cancer cell. And that of course was the immune system. You know, people were very skeptical but that he showed that if you made a bacterial lysate from those patients and bottled it up, he called Coley’s Toxins and it worked on some patients, but there was a huge amount of skepticism and then radiation therapy and chemotherapy. And of course Sidney Farber who founded the Dana Farber cancer center was the first person to cure childhood leukemia with chemotherapy. He’s really the father of modern chemotherapy. They supplanted Coley’s Toxins and they worked for some patients, but immunologists and cancer biologists have worked for a century on trying to activate the immune system. And they finally broke the barrier with those checkpoint blockers against two inhibitory receptors on the T lymphocyte, the ones I mentioned, that PD1, PDL1 pathway. And Dana Farber was obviously a part of that. And another receptor called CTLA4, which the drug Yervoy from Bristol Myers Squibb targeted. And that just changed the entire landscape of immunotherapy. I’m not saying we don’t have a long ways to go. We do. We still can only treat about 20% of all patients, but you know, prior to that, prior to the last 15 years we could treat 0% of patients with immunotherapy. It’s enormous progress. And if you look at the landscape now, we’re identifying dozens of new targets for immunotherapy.

So I feel like if you look at the way we’re treating cancer over the last hundreds of years, 20 years ago, we started to bend the curve. It became an exponential curve from a flat survival rate, didn’t change, to a exponential increase in survival rates. And right now with the number of new targets that have been discovered, we are at an incredible inflection point. Think of it this way: there are 20,000 human proteins, about 20,000 human genes and human proteins. Do you know how many of those are targeted by the drugs that are currently out in the market? Only about somewhere between 750 and a thousand. Think of all the targets and all the proteins that have been assumed to be non-druggable. Well they’re not non-druggable. We have a huge opportunity ahead of us. Things like transcription factors, for example, were assumed to be a non-targetable protein category, but what if you could degrade and that was because their shape, when you look at their protein shape, it’s very difficult to develop a drug that inhibits them, but the protein degradation technology, which is now the latest, I mean really remarkable technique in which you actually target a protein, not by finding a small molecule that disables them, but by degrading them, causing them to be degraded. And that’s work from Nathanael Gray and Eric Fischer here at Dana Farber and a few other scientists at other institutions. But this is our recent collaboration with Deerfield for example, where they’ve given us a tremendous amount of support to start figuring out how to degrade so many other proteins that have been previously considered to be undruggable. And we’ve seen success in that already. So to me, the future is even more promising than the last 15 years. And then the last 15 years have been remarkable.

Billy Starr: Well, that’s correct. Most people get their history wrong. We’ve been the largest fundraising event for the Jimmy Fund since 1984. I think it’s fair to say in the first decade, for me it was about getting this event launched, and even though by 1989 we had some 1200 riders. We were going to give a gift of over $1 million for the very first year. The nuts and bolts of building this event, you know, the way we did, took a considerable amount of time. It was also, I’ve worked for 10 years alone before I hired my first full time person in 1990. I probably would’ve done better by hiring sooner, but nonetheless, you know, the mission of funding cancer research really became much more of a center in the 90s and thereafter. As some money grew, the fundraising tools grew that we developed and the fact that we were able to just keep overhead so low, it was very much resonating with people. 1990 was the first time that I was passing through ninety cents on the dollar and then I start promoting that. And we’ve gone only one way then. We’re in our 13th consecutive year of 100% passthrough having just included our second strategic business plan in the last seven years. That hundred percent pass through turns out to be the critical aspect of galvanizing this type of aggressive dynamic fundraising as it’s been identified as the number one, the PMC DNA, more than riding on the weekend with loved ones, more than funding cancer research at Dana Farber itself. The hundred passthrough. So, the business model, you know, it took years for it to really grab aggressively, it has been proven to be quite successful, very dynamic. And now events all over the country are being modeled after it.

We have a team out of Connecticut, Team Brent, named after this boy Brent McCreesh who was diagnosed when he was 10 months old with neuroblastoma. He was seen at Yale and at Sloan Kettering and then he ended up coming to Children’s Hospital for surgery and Dana Farber where the neuroblastoma team is probably the best in the world. He is now 16 and doing really well. His team has raised over $7 million since they started riding and they give their money directly to the head of neuroblastoma. So this Dr. Lisa Diller, when they said, what do you need us to fund? She said there is not a MIBG room, which is a specific lead lined room that treats refractory neuroblastoma patients. There were none in New England. The closest one was in New York and there were only 10 in the country. So, I don’t know the exact price tag, but millions. And they kicked off the gifts and paid for this room, which now kids can come from anywhere, mostly in new England, to be treated in this lead lined room at Children’s Hospital. So even though it’s Dana Farber, it’s Children’s Hospital, it’s kids from everywhere, from all over the world who use this room that was funded by Team Brent of PMC.

Katie Janeway: Sure. So I’ll focus in this interview on the work that I do as director of clinical genomics and as a researcher who focuses on what’s called precision oncology. All oncology care is precise, meaning that we’re very careful about coming up with a diagnosis and we use that diagnosis, and also the stage, meaning how extensive is the cancer? To carefully select a treatment plan. But there’s been a major sort of revolution in science and health care in the past 10 years. And we put together that revolution in the genomics with recent developments in the drugs that we have available to us to create a sort of new paradigm for being precise in our care of oncology patients.
Emily Kumler: And so that means like looking at the specific tumor markers or something that you can then treat in a different way than we used to do, where we would just sort of treat the whole body?
Katie Janeway: That’s correct. So our traditional treatment for cancer is what we call a sort of, to use a wastebasket term, chemotherapy. And what chemotherapy does is, it kills rapidly dividing cells. Cancer is usually the most rapidly dividing cell in the body. The chemotherapy works the most against the cancer but also affects other rapidly dividing cells like your hair, which is why hair tends to fall out during cancer chemotherapy treatment. In this new paradigm of precision oncology, what we do is we use very sophisticated genomic sequencing tasks where we can read the DNA or the instruction manual of the cells in the cancer that particular patient has and we identify the errors that are sort of turning the cancer on or driving it. And that’s one piece, what we call tumor profiling. The other piece is that we have more precise drugs now, which we call targeted therapy or molecularly targeted therapy and those drugs specifically counter out act or turn off the effect of those gene errors or gene abnormalities that are driving the cancer.
Emily Kumler: And that’s really important because when you’re doing chemotherapy the old way, you had to kill a lot of really healthy cells in the process, right?
Katie Janeway: That’s right.
Emily Kumler: The goal with this sort of new technology or new, you know, medication is to kill less of the healthy cells. And really focus in on the cancer cells. Is that accurate?
Katie Janeway: That’s absolutely correct and so people who are taking these new molecularly targeted therapies, there are a couple of advantages. First, they tend to be oral medications. They’re taken as a pill, whereas the old chemotherapy was given intravenously. What that means is you can receive your treatment at home for the most part without admission to the hospital, without frequent visits to the doctor. And then because they are specifically counteracting something that’s abnormal in the cancer cell, they tend to have much fewer side effects such that people tend to be able to go about their usual activities of life. And for the children that I treat, that tends to mean going to school, playing with their friends, being home with their siblings and their parents.

Emily Kumler: With regards to pediatrics specifically, this is just sort of a random question that occurred to me, but like do kids have more rapidly dividing cells that are not cancerous? Because they’re growing?
Katie Janeway: Oh, this is a great question. So the real question you’re asking is does the chemotherapy have more side effects for a young person? Because their bodies are also growing? The answer to that question is in some ways no and in some ways, yes. So for the what we call the acute side effects, which is what happens right away, those tend to be the same in adults and children. But one of the things that we’re really concerned about when treating children with cancer is what are the long-term side effects or what we call the late effects? Does the chemotherapy itself cause problems later down the road? Because as we cure more and more childhood cancers, we have to think about how does that impact their life, you know, long term. And we do see some specific concerns or side effects related to that sort of long-term view of the side effects.
Emily Kumler: And so that’s not the kind of thing that can be combated with these more precise treatments?
Katie Janeway: Well, it’s a great question. We don’t know yet. Long term takes time. That’s right. So this precision oncology approach is relatively new. The Pan Mass Challenge funds that we’ve received through the team Precision for Kids, who rides our precision oncology research in children, is relatively new. We’ve been, you know, at this for less than 10 years. We don’t yet know whether these new, more precise medications that have fewer side effects in the short term also have fewer side effects in the long term.

So, the precision oncology for children is supported by the Precision for Kids team, that I run, is focused on younger children, adolescents, and young adults who have more difficult to treat what we call solid cancers. Meaning there are lumps and bumps that occur in the body and we focus on the solid cancers outside the brain for these most challenging to treat cancers for every patient who enters our study. We are conducting pretty comprehensive tumor profiling to try to find those gene abnormalities and then we provide additional interpretation or information for the doctor so that they can then go on to select a clinical trial or a drug that’s already available for that child, based on the tumor profiling that we have performed. And we have right now almost 500 children who are participating in the study. And again all of that is supported by philanthropic funds and a huge amount of that is from the Pan Mass Challenge funding. And within the group of children that we’ve looked at so far, which is about 350 of these children with very difficult to treat cancers, we already have, you know, a handful of patients whose lives have been completely transformed by this precision oncology approach where they’ve gone from having difficult to diagnose or difficult to treat cancers, to having a precise diagnosis, to having the identification of one of these gene errors that’s driving the cancers to receiving one of these match targeted therapies and having tumors that were progressing on chemotherapy and were metastatic suddenly responding to the targeted therapy. And having way fewer side effects and allowing them to go back to school, and to be home with their families and their parents instead of in the hospital receiving treatment with a lot of side effects.

Katie Janeway: We are often surprised by what gene abnormality or mutation we find in a particular cancer. That’s why in some ways the tumor profiling approach is so important because what you’re doing is instead of trying to guess what the cancer has and doing one test after another to try to find that abnormality, you’re just saying, let’s see if the tumor has any one of these hundreds of abnormalities that I’m able to test for using this new testing approach. And so it allows us to find those surprising or unexpected gene abnormalities that are driving the cancer. Whereas previously we had to guess what might be there and do one test after another to try to find what we thought might be there.
Emily Kumler: Well, and you don’t know what you don’t know. So like, if you don’t have a test for it, it doesn’t mean that there isn’t one. It just means you don’t have a way of identifying it. So if you didn’t have the funding from the PMC, would this study still go on?
New Speaker: No, it would not. We certainly have applied for grants for this type of research, but it is a difficult type of research to obtain traditional grant funding for. Traditional grant funding plays an incredibly important role in research in cancer. I don’t want to understate that. But there are types of research like this that are what we call translational, meaning they sit between the basic science laboratories and our sort of standard clinical care that are more difficult to fund in our traditional grant funding structure. So without philanthropic funds and funds from the PMs challenge, we certainly would not be able to do this study.
